Tasting Note

Blackcurrant and plum with cedar, tobacco, violet and menthol; spice and subtle vanilla from oak. Silky medium‑full body, firm chewy tannins, bright acidity and a long, elegant finish.


Food Pairing

Western: roast lamb, ribeye or beef short ribs, duck confit, mushroom risotto. Asian: Peking duck, char siu, Korean bulgogi or BBQ beef, soy-ginger glazed short ribs, Sichuan beef with moderate spice.


Production Method

Parcel-by-parcel fermentation in temperature-controlled stainless steel vats; malolactic in vat; aged ~18 months in French oak (≈60% new).


Vineyard Info

Deuxième Cru Classé (1855) in Margaux; owned by the Wertheimer/Chanel family since 1994. Estate ~51–52 ha; second wine is Ségla; modernized viticulture and cellar practices.
